Technical Problem

Existing English translators require users to hold them for extended periods, leading to hand muscle tension and fatigue, restricting freedom of movement, and reducing comfort and convenience.

Method used

A portable English translator was designed, employing a portable mechanism including a base, straps, L-shaped links, limiting blocks, and pressing rods. This allows the translator to be secured to the user's wrist via the straps, avoiding handheld use and ensuring stability and easy disassembly.

Benefits of technology

This eliminates the need for users to hold the translator, improving wearing comfort and versatility, reducing hand fatigue, and enhancing efficiency and safety.

Abstract

The utility model belongs to the field of English translators, and particularly relates to a portable English translator which comprises a translator body, a portable mechanism is arranged at the bottom of the translator body, the portable mechanism comprises a base, the base is fixedly connected to the bottom of the translator body, a first binding band is arranged on one side of the base, and a second binding band is arranged on the other side of the base. A first binding band is arranged on one side of the base, a second binding band is arranged on the other side of the base, two L-shaped connecting rods are fixedly connected to one end of each of the first binding band and the second binding band, the first binding band and the second binding band are movably connected with the base through the L-shaped connecting rods, limiting blocks are arranged on the inner wall of the base, and a pressing rod is fixedly connected to one side of each limiting block. Through the arrangement of the portable mechanism, the wrist size of different users can be flexibly adapted through the cooperative use of the first bandage and the second bandage, the L-shaped connecting rod is limited through the structure of the pressing rod and the limiting block, and the wearing stability is ensured.

TECHNICAL FIELD

[0001] The utility model relates to the field of english translator, concretely is a portable english translator. BACKGROUND

[0002] The english translator is a kind of electronic device that can automatically interpret between one language and English, it utilizes speech recognition, natural language processing, machine translation etc., realizes language conversion of text or voice form, helps user to cross language barrier and communicates.

[0003] Part of english translator needs user to always hold in hand when using, not only limit the freedom of body movement of user when communicating, user will also cause hand muscle tension and fatigue to intensify due to long time holding, reduce the comfort and convenience of use. [0024] The embodiments of the application disclose a portable English translator. Referring to Figure 1 , Figure 2 , Figure 3 Figure 4 and Figure 5 , a portable English translator comprises a translator body 1, and the bottom of the translator body 1 is provided with a portable mechanism 2.

[0025] The portable mechanism 2 comprises a base 204, the base 204 is fixedly connected to the bottom of the translator body 1, one side of the base 204 is provided with a first strap 201, the other side of the base 204 is provided with a second strap 202, one end of the first strap 201 and the second strap 202 is fixedly connected with two L-shaped connecting rods 205, the L-shaped connecting rods 205 are movably connected to the inner wall of the base 204, the first strap 201 and the second strap 202 are movably connected with the base 204 through the L-shaped connecting rods 205, the inner wall of the base 204 is provided with limiting blocks 206, the number of the limiting blocks 206 is four, every two limiting blocks 206 form a group, the limiting blocks 206 are used in cooperation with the L-shaped connecting rods 205, one side of each limiting block 206 is fixedly connected with a pressing rod 203, one end of the pressing rod 203 penetrates to the outside of the base 204, by setting the portable mechanism 2, the first strap 201 and the second strap 202 are used in cooperation, different user wrist sizes can be flexibly adapted, the situation that the user needs to hold for a long time is avoided, the L-shaped connecting rods 205 are limited through the structure of the pressing rod 203 and the limiting blocks 206, the stability during wearing is ensured, and the installation and removal process of the first strap 201 and the second strap 202 becomes simple and fast, the wearing comfort and the universality are improved.

[0026] Referring to Figure 2The surface of the first binding belt 201 is provided with a plurality of holes 4, and the other end of the first binding belt 201 is fixedly connected with a mounting block 3. The second binding belt 202 is movably connected to the inner cavity of the mounting block 3. The holes 4 and the mounting block 3 are arranged to facilitate the positioning of the second binding belt 202 by the first binding belt 201, prevent the interpreter body 1 from deviating or falling off during wearing, and improve the overall safety.

[0027] Referring to Figure 3 The other end of the second binding belt 202 is fixedly connected with a limiting column 5, and the top of the limiting column 5 is fixedly connected with a clamping block 6. The limiting column 5 and the clamping block 6 are used in cooperation with the holes 4. The limiting column 5 and the clamping block 6 can adapt to different wrist sizes of users, prevent the second binding belt 202 from being separated from the first binding belt 201, and ensure the stability and safety of the interpreter body 1 during wearing.

[0028] Referring to Figure 4 and Figure 5 Both sides of the base 204 are provided with two mounting grooves 7, and the L-shaped connecting rod 205 is movably connected to the inner wall of the mounting groove 7. The mounting groove 7 provides a moving space for the L-shaped connecting rod 205, ensures that the L-shaped connecting rod 205 can be connected to the base 204, and improves the stability of the connection.

[0029] Referring to Figure 5 Both sides of the base 204 are provided with two limiting grooves 8, and the surfaces of the two groups of limiting blocks 206 are in contact with the inner walls of the limiting grooves 8. The limiting grooves 8 provide a moving space for the limiting blocks 206, facilitate the limiting blocks 206 to cancel the limiting of the L-shaped connecting rod 205, and facilitate the disassembly of the second binding belt 202 and the first binding belt 201.

[0030] Referring to Figure 5 The opposite sides of the two groups of limiting blocks 206 are fixedly connected with springs 11, and the springs 11 are arranged in the inner cavities of the limiting grooves 8. The springs 11 provide elastic potential energy for the limiting blocks 206, ensure that the limiting blocks 206 can return to the original position after moving, and ensure the stability of the limiting blocks 206.

[0031] Referring to Figure 5 The bottoms of the two groups of limiting blocks 206 are fixedly connected with sliding blocks 9, and the inner walls of the two mounting grooves 7 are provided with sliding grooves 10. The surfaces of the sliding blocks 9 are in contact with the inner walls of the sliding grooves 10. The limiting blocks 206 are slidably connected to the inner walls of the base 204 through the sliding blocks 9 and the sliding grooves 10. The sliding grooves 10 and the sliding blocks 9 can guide the limiting blocks 206, ensure that the limiting blocks 206 move along the preset path, and prevent the limiting blocks 206 from deviating.

[0032] Working principle: when the user needs to use the translator body 1, and needs to release both hands, the user passes the second band 202 through the mounting block 3, then passes the limiting column 5 and the clamping block 6 through the hole 4 of the first band 201, fixes the first band 201 and the second band 202 through the clamping block 6, adjusts the position of the limiting column 5 and the clamping block 6 in the hole 4, so as to adapt to the wrist size of different users, the first band 201, the second band 202, the mounting block 3, the limiting column 5 and the clamping block 6 are all made of rubber material, the rubber has good elasticity and recovery ability, can adapt to a certain degree of deformation, the rubber material makes the limiting column 5 and the clamping block 6 deform easily to pass through the hole 4, and restore to the original shape after passing through, provide stable fixing effect, by wearing the translator body 1 on the wrist, the user does not need to hold the device, so as to freely carry out other activities, at the same time, the user can start the translation function immediately when needed, without taking the device from the bag, improve the response speed and use efficiency, the wrist wearing mode not only facilitates carrying, but also reduces the risk of loss, under normal circumstances, the first band 201 and the second band 202 are connected with the base 204 through the L-shaped connecting rod 205 and are locked on the inner wall of the base 204 by the limiting block 206, when the first band 201 and the second band 202 need to be replaced, the user presses the pressing rod 203 on both sides of the base 204 at the same time, the pressing rod 203 is pressed, the limiting block 206 and the sliding block 9 connected with the pressing rod 203 move along the path of the sliding groove 10, with the movement of the limiting block 206, the limiting block 206 enters the limiting groove 8, the limiting block 206 gradually cancels the locking effect of the L-shaped connecting rod 205, at the same time, the pressing of the pressing rod 203 also exerts pressure on the spring 11 through the limiting block 206, so that the spring 11 is compressed and stores elastic potential energy, providing elastic potential energy for the pressing rod 203 and the limiting block 206, so that the pressing rod 203 and the limiting block 206 can restore to the original position, when the limiting block 206 completely moves out of the locking position, the L-shaped connecting rod 205 is no longer limited, allowing the first band 201 and the second band 202 to be separated from the inner wall of the base 204, at this time, the user can easily take off the old first band 201 and the second band 202.
